How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Adrian?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Adrian Studio Apartments | $640 | $520 | $745 |
Adrian 1 Bedroom Apartments | $944 | $550 | $1,500 |
Adrian 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,150 | $540 | $2,584 |
Adrian 3 Bedroom Apartments | $949 | $400 | $3,632 |
Adrian 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,088 | $600 | $1,700 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Adrian
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Adrian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Adrian ranges from $550 to $1,500 with an average monthly rent of $944.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Adrian c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Adrian range from $540 to $2,584.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,150.
How expensive are Adrian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 13 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Adrian on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$400 to $3,632 - averaging $949 for the location.
